Description

Valve for sewage discharge
Technical Field
The utility model relates to the technical field of valves, specifically be a valve for blowdown.
Background
The valve is a pipeline accessory used for opening and closing a pipeline, controlling the flow direction, adjusting and controlling parameters (temperature, pressure and flow) of a conveying medium, and the valve is a control part in a fluid conveying system and has the functions of stopping, adjusting, guiding, preventing backflow, stabilizing pressure, shunting or overflowing and relieving pressure, and the like.

Drawings
FIG. 1 is a schematic three-dimensional cross-sectional view of the structure of the present invention;
FIG. 2 is a sectional elevation view of the structure of the present invention;
FIG. 3 is a right side schematic view of the structure of the present invention;
FIG. 4 is a left side schematic view of the structure of the present invention;
fig. 5 is an overall three-dimensional schematic diagram of the structure of the present invention.
In the figure: the device comprises a valve outer box 1, a water inlet connector 2, a sealing cover 3, a water inlet pipe 4, a threaded sleeve 5, a fixed sleeve 6, a rotating sleeve 7, a bearing 8, a check plug 9, a check frame 10, a water outlet connector 11, a water outlet pipe 12, a stirring fan 13, a rotating rod 14, a fixed pipe 15, a bevel gear I16, a bevel gear II 17, a rotating shaft 18, a power box 19, a servo motor 20, a screw rod 21, a fixed bearing 22 and a connecting pipe 23.
Detailed Description
According to the utility model discloses an aspect, the utility model provides a valve for blowdown, as shown in fig. 1-5, including valve outer container 1, one side of valve outer container 1 bottom and one side fixed connection of headstock 19, the bottom of headstock 19 inner wall and servo motor 20's bottom fixed connection, one side of servo motor 20 is through the one end fixed connection of pivot with dwang 14, and the other end of dwang 14 runs through fixed connection in the fixed pipe 15 of outlet pipe 12 one side, and the one end of fixed pipe 15 and the one end fixed connection of play water connector 11 are kept away from to outlet pipe 12.
The outer surface of one end of a rotating rod 14 is inserted into the middle of a bevel gear 16, one side of the outer surface of the bevel gear 16 is meshed with one side of the outer surface of a bevel gear 17, the middle of the bevel gear 17 is fixedly connected with the bottom of a rotating shaft 18, the outer surface of the middle of the rotating shaft 18 is fixedly provided with a rotating sleeve 7, the outer surfaces of the rotating sleeve 7 and the rotating rod 14 are respectively provided with a stirring fan 13, the surface of the rotating sleeve 7 is provided with the stirring fan 13, so that impurities in a valve can be cleaned through the stirring fan 13, the top of the rotating shaft 18 penetrates through a sealing cover 3 fixedly connected to the bottom of a water inlet pipe 4 to be rotatably connected with the bottom of a fixed bearing 22, the number of the sealing covers 3 is two, the two sealing covers 3 are symmetrically arranged at two sides of the water inlet pipe 4, the two sealing covers 3 are arranged, so that the upper side and the lower side of the water inlet pipe 4 can be sealed, and sewage in the water inlet pipe 4 can be prevented from flowing out, the tightness of the water inlet pipe 4 is improved, the top of the fixed bearing 22 is fixedly connected with the top of the inner wall of the water inlet pipe 4, one end of the water inlet pipe 4 is fixedly connected with one side of the connecting pipe 23, the middle part of the inner wall of the connecting pipe 23 is fixedly provided with the check frame 10, the middle part of the check frame 10 is provided with a round hole with the diameter smaller than that of the check plug 9, the check plug 9 is convenient to control sewage by arranging the check frame 10, the control effect of the valve is improved, the top of the connecting pipe 23 is fixedly connected with the top of the inner wall of the valve outer box 1, the top of the valve outer box 1 is fixedly provided with the threaded sleeve 5, the outer surface of the threaded sleeve 5 is fixedly provided with the fixed sleeve 6, the bottom of the fixed sleeve 6 is fixedly connected with the top of the valve outer box 1, the threaded sleeve 5 is convenient to be fixed by arranging the fixed sleeve 6, meanwhile, the sewage in the valve is prevented from flowing out, and the sealing effect is achieved, the inner ring of the threaded sleeve 5 is in threaded connection with the middle of the outer surface of the screw rod 21, the threads on the outer surface of the screw rod 21 are opposite to the threads inside the threaded sleeve 5, the threads are not arranged at the positions where the screw rod 21 is in threaded connection with the bearing 8, opposite threads are arranged, the screw rod 21 can drive the check plug 9 in the rotating process, the valve is blocked and opened, the bottom of the screw rod 21 is rotatably connected with the top of the bearing 8, and the bottom of the bearing 8 is fixedly connected with the top of the check plug 9.

The working principle is as follows: during the use, through servo motor 20 as power, drive dwang 14 and rotate, dwang 14 pivoted in-process drives surperficial stirring fan 13 and rotates, reach and stir to the inside sewage impurity of outlet pipe 12, prevent the effect of jam, bevel gear 16 drives bevel gear two 17 in the pivoted in-process and rotates, bevel gear two 17 drives axis of rotation 18 at the pivoted in-process and rotates, reach and drive the stirring fan 13 on rotating sleeve 7 surface and rotate, solve the effect of the inside impurity of inlet tube 4.

Claims (6)

1. The utility model provides a valve for blowdown, includes valve outer container (1), its characterized in that: one side of the bottom of the valve outer box (1) is fixedly connected with one side of the power box (19), the bottom of the inner wall of the power box (19) is fixedly connected with the bottom of the servo motor (20), one side of the servo motor (20) is fixedly connected with one end of the rotating rod (14) through a rotating shaft, the other end of the rotating rod (14) penetrates through the fixed pipe (15) fixedly connected to one side of the water outlet pipe (12), and one end, far away from the fixed pipe (15), of the water outlet pipe (12) is fixedly connected with one end of the water outlet connector (11);
the outer surface of one end of the rotating rod (14) is inserted into the middle of the first bevel gear (16), one side of the outer surface of the first bevel gear (16) is meshed with one side of the outer surface of the second bevel gear (17), the middle of the second bevel gear (17) is fixedly connected with the bottom of the rotating shaft (18), the top of the rotating shaft (18) penetrates through a sealing cover (3) fixedly connected to the bottom of the water inlet pipe (4) to be rotatably connected with the bottom of a fixed bearing (22), the top of the fixed bearing (22) is fixedly connected with the top of the inner wall of the water inlet pipe (4), one end of the water inlet pipe (4) is fixedly connected with one side of a connecting pipe (23), the top of the connecting pipe (23) is fixedly connected with the top of the inner wall of the valve outer box (1), a threaded sleeve (5) is fixedly arranged at the top of the valve outer box (1), the inner ring of the threaded sleeve (5) is in threaded connection with the middle of the outer surface of the screw rod (21), the bottom of the screw rod (21) is rotatably connected with the top of the bearing (8), the bottom of the bearing (8) is fixedly connected with the top of the check plug (9).
2. A waste valve as claimed in claim 1, wherein: the outer surface of the middle part of the rotating shaft (18) is fixedly provided with a rotating sleeve (7), and the outer surfaces of the rotating sleeve (7) and the rotating rod (14) are provided with stirring fan blades (13).
3. A waste valve as claimed in claim 1, wherein: the middle part of the inner wall of the connecting pipe (23) is fixedly provided with a check frame (10), and the middle part of the check frame (10) is provided with a round hole with the diameter smaller than that of the check plug (9).
4. A waste valve as claimed in claim 1, wherein: the outer surface of the threaded sleeve (5) is fixedly provided with a fixed sleeve (6), and the bottom of the fixed sleeve (6) is fixedly connected with the top of the valve outer box (1).
5. A waste valve as claimed in claim 1, wherein: the thread of the outer surface of the screw rod (21) is opposite to the thread of the inner part of the threaded sleeve (5), and the position where the screw rod (21) is in threaded connection with the bearing (8) is not provided with the thread.
6. A waste valve as claimed in claim 1, wherein: the number of the sealing covers (3) is two, and the two sealing covers (3) are symmetrically arranged on two sides of the water inlet pipe (4).
